Tips for finding books about and from Southeast Asia
Books about Southeast Asia in general can be found by searching on the subject term "Southeast Asia." If you are looking for works on a particular country, use the country name in your search. You can also search by the the names of peoples and languages, "Indonesian" for instance, or you can use "Indonesia" with the truncation symbol "Indonesia*" to find all instances of both "Indonesia" and "Indonesian." Try a keyword search first and look at the assigned Subject Headings to refine your search. Note that you can limit any search by language, if you are looking for foreign language materials
Plurals, truncation, and wildcards (UW WorldCat)
Use + for plurals (s and es)
Use * for truncation
Use # for a wildcard character
Use ?N for up to N characters
In Process Items
Many books in the Southeast Asia collection, particularly those in languages of Southeast Asia, are not yet fully cataloged. Many of these "In Process" titles do not appear in the WorldCat prefered UW catalog search option. If you are looking for vernacular titles, you should search the UW Catalog, which includes these "In Process" records. Note that most of these records do not have Subject Headings, so you need to search using a keyword in the language you are looking for.
Non Roman Script Materials
The UW Catalog does not represent non-roman scripts, such as Thai or Burmese. These languages are transliterated into roman alphabet. We use the Library of Congress Transliteration Tables to represent these languages. You need to become familiar with this table in order to search the catalog in Thai, Burmese or Khmer. Note that you do not have to input the diacritic marks to search in the catalog. See General Information on Diacritics and Special Characters.
Note on Vietnamese Language
Vietnamese language displays imperfectly in the catalog. You cannot search using Vietnamese diacritics, but the catalog will find every variant of the word you are searching, regardless of diacritics. Often this means that you have to qualify your search by using more than one term. See General Information on Diacritics and Special Characters.
